    The wait time to get an ADHD diagnosis could be a major obstacle. In the absence of a system that NHS is properly resourced, many adults will have to turn to private clinics to get diagnosed.

    But the BBC Panorama investigation has shown that some private clinics are handing out unreliable diagnoses. This puts vulnerable patients at risk.

    Some private adhd assessment sheffield cost clinics provide quick ADHD assessments but they are not always accurate. In reality, they do not adhere to national guidelines, and may give patients the wrong diagnosis. This was revealed by the BBC Panorama investigation. The report found that three private clinics diagnosed an undercover journalist through video calls even though an even more thorough NHS examination revealed that there was no evidence of ADHD.     While private treatment can be a good option, they can also be costly. This may cause an issue if you need to have your prescription renewed often. You can sign a shared-care agreement with your GP. This means you only pay for prescription fees when you actually need the medication. This is a great option if you're looking to save money.

    The psychiatrist will not just evaluate your symptoms but also other factors that could affect your health. For instance co-morbidities. These assessments may require up to two sessions to be completed. The assessment will include an interview with a clinician and rating scales. The psychiatrist will discuss your symptoms and how they impact your daily life. It can be difficult to explain, so having someone from your family to support is helpful.

    Some clinicians are too quick to grab a pen and write a prescription without conducting a thorough examination. This type of "drive-thru" evaluation is more likely to result in an inaccurate diagnosis. If a doctor wants to prescribe ADHD medication for children, he or she must review the completed teacher rating scales and interview educators as part an interview with a clinician. This requires time and effort, but it's crucial to establish a correct diagnosis.

    If you are considering a private ADHD clinic, ensure that the clinicians are qualified to diagnose the condition. It is crucial to conduct a thorough examination and the doctor must consider the patient's past as well as their environment. In addition, they should follow the NHS's guidelines for diagnosing ADHD. A reputable clinic must be willing to provide you with an additional opinion if it is not certain of its diagnosis.

    Some private clinics are accused of not providing accurate assessments of adult ADHD. Panorama, an investigation by the BBC investigation, spoke with dozens of patients who claimed that private clinics were speeding through assessments or not adhering to guidelines.
